The ANC has vowed to reflect on the political implications of the DA's decision to withdraw from the National Dialogue following the dismissal of its deputy minister Andrew Whitfield. The DA has also called on civil society organisations to reconsider their support for the dialogue. Last week President Cyril Ramaphosa fired Whitfield for undertaking a US trip without authorisation. But DA leader John Steenhuisen says Ramaphosa's action was unfair as he fails to act against errant ANC ministers like Nobuhle Nkabane and Thembi Simelane.
